The Future of Cybersecurity Includes Non-Human Employees

6 days agoThe Hacker News

Summary

Non-human employees are becoming the future of cybersecurity, and enterprises need to prepare accordingly. As organizations scale Artificial Intelligence (AI) and cloud automation, there is exponential growth in Non-Human Identities (NHIs), including bots, AI agents, service accounts and automation scripts. Sector Impact

The cybersecurity sector faces a paradigm shift as it integrates AI agents and automated scripts into its workforce. This requires cybersecurity firms to develop specialized expertise in securing NHIs, adapt their service offerings to address the unique challenges posed by AI-driven identities, and navigate the evolving regulatory landscape surrounding AI in security operations.

Analysis Perspective
Executive Perspective

Organizations must adapt their identity governance strategies to manage and secure the growing number of AI-driven NHIs, which requires new tools and processes for access control, monitoring, and auditing. Effectively managing NHIs is essential for maintaining security posture, preventing data breaches, and ensuring compliance.
